NENU held its 2006 seminar on postgraduate program administration in Jilin City from June 10th to 11th. Su Zhongmin, Dean of NENU’s Postgraduate School, explained the aim and significance of the seminar, which was attended by more than fifty people including the coordinators and supervisors of the various postgraduate programs as well as the staff from the School of Postgraduates.
The seminar was divided into two sessions, one for postgraduate coordinators and the other on ethical standards for postgraduate students. The coordinators discussed and shared their ideas on issues such as the enrollment of postgraduates, the administration of online education, theses defenses, etc. In addition, the postgraduate supervisors reflected on their roles and spoke out on issues such as the development of their team, their working goals and discussed their compensation package.
